Night shift: evacuation-chair store on Stairwell C, Level 3, was restocked today. Two Havermont chairs serviced, one sent to Drayle Safety for repair. Check the seal on the store door at 02:00 rounds. If the seal is broken, log it and re-secure. Door access for the store uses the pass below.

staff pass of fajop-kajop = bdg-H-83

Welcome to the Hollyvane rendering rotation. Template render p95 normally sits under 120ms; alerts fire at 400ms sustained for five minutes. The usual culprit is partial-cache eviction after a deploy — warm the cache before paging anyone else. If latency persists past two warm cycles, roll back. Warm-up steps and rollback criteria are documented on the internal runbook page.

runbook for kajof-bahif: https://sentry.ferranet.local/merge_requests/repo/projects/view/81769af030f7d6d2

## Authentication

Bulk edits in the Ledgerette admin table go through the internal batch endpoint. Plugin authors must not call it directly; use the `bulkApply()` helper, which handles retries and row locking. Every batch request requires a key header — unsigned requests are dropped without error detail. For sandbox testing, authenticate with the key below.

app token of bahaf-tajeg = zpat23_SjjsllwiLmXbtS65veZaV47

# Break-Glass: Catalog Cache Invalidation

Scope: the Pinrow product catalog at Veldstone Retail. If stale prices persist after a purge and the Hollowmere invalidation queue is wedged, use break-glass to flush the edge tier directly. Contractors: get verbal sign-off from the catalog lead first. Steps: open the Hollowmere admin shell, select emergency-flush, confirm the tenant, and run it once — repeated flushes thrash the origin. Access is logged and expires after 20 minutes. Unseal the admin shell with the passphrase below.

recovery phrase for kahop-tajog: istix-casvan

14:32 — Dalia confirmed the tax-rate lookup cache in Quillbook's checkout service had been serving stale entries for the Norvane region since the 09:10 deploy. The TTL refresh job silently failed because the rate-table schema migration renamed a column the job still referenced. We invalidated the cache cluster manually at 14:40 and rates corrected within two minutes. For cross-referencing with the deploy logs, reviewers should use the trace token recorded below.

pipeline stamp: htk4_ae36